About The Position

The Department of Orthopaedic Surgery at the University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ine is seeking to hire full-time faculty members at the Assistant Professor level in the appointment (non-tenure) stream. The selected candidate will be actively engaged in patient care, teaching medical students, residents, and fellows, and conducting orthopaedic research as directed by the Chair and division chief. This position is specifically for recruitment within the Primary Care Sports Medicine subspecialty program.

Requirements

  • A medical degree from an accredited medical school.
  • Completion of an accredited residency program in a primary care specialty (e.g., Family Medicine, Internal Medicine, Emergency Medicine, or Pediatrics).
  • Completion of an ACGME-accredited Primary Care Sports Medicine Fellowship.
  • Board certification in primary specialty, with a Certificate of Added Qualification (CAQ) in Sports Medicine or eligibility with a plan to obtain within six months.
  • Eligibility for licensure in the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ania.
  • Proficiency in musculoskeletal ultrasound and familiarity with orthobiologics.
  • Demonstrated ability to communicate effectively, collaborate within a multidisciplinary performance team, and thrive in a high-volume clinical environment.
  • Qualified physician applicants must meet the minimum position credentials for the orthopaedic specialty to provide clinical service.
  • Candidates should demonstrate a strong interest and ability in clinical care and teaching.
  • Possess strong clinical, interpersonal, analytical, and writing skills.
  • A record of scholarly publications and presentations is expected.
  • Evidence of interest in and involvement in research is expected.

Responsibilities

  • Actively involved in patient care.
  • Medical student, resident, and fellow teaching.
  • Orthopaedic research as determined by the Chair and associated division chief.
